A new addition to the menu at Cosmic Ray’s Starlight Café is this little chocolate Bundt cake with a purple icing drizzle. We stopped by to give it a try (and listen to Sonny Eclipse, of course).
Chocolate Bundt Cake — $5.49
The purple icing is pretty, but there’s not enough to add any flavor.
The cake itself is a little dry, and the small amount of icing did nothing to help that. It’s a decent dark chocolate cake with rich flavor, but definitely have a drink handy!
There are melted chocolate chips throughout, which was a nice surprise.
Other than it being dry, we enjoyed this treat. It’s a simple cake that would be good for a picky eater. We would not get it again simply because there are better choices around Magic Kingdom, such as the fan-favorite Cheshire Tails nearby at Cheshire Café.
